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Luxemburg

** The Mazda repair market for residents of Luxemburg, Iowa, is characterized by a reliance on service providers in larger neighboring towns, primarily Dubuque (~15 miles away) and Dyersville (~8 miles away). There are no dedicated Mazda repair shops within Luxemburg itself. **Average Quality:** The quality of service is generally high, with several long-standing, reputable businesses serving the region. The presence of a dealership (Carousel) ensures access to factory-level expertise, while independent shops like Mittermeier Motors offer specialized knowledge often at a more competitive rate.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ate within the Dubuque County area. Customers have a clear choice between the dealership for warranty work and complex electronic diagnostics and several highly-rated independents for general maintenance, performance work, and potentially lower-cost repairs.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. The dealership typically commands the highest labor rates, reflecting their manufacturer-specific training and tools. Independent specialists offer intermediate pricing, generally 15-25% lower than the dealer, while general repair shops are the most budget-friendly but lack Mazda-specific expertise. For the specialized services requested, expect to pay a premium for the required knowledge and diagnostic equipment.

What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Luxemburg climate?

Given Iowa's harsh winters with road salt, rust and corrosion on brake lines and undercarriages are common concerns. For Mazdas, particularly older models, this can accelerate wear on suspension components. Additionally, ensuring the battery and charging system are robust is key for reliable cold-weather starts.

How do I choose between a dealership and an independent shop for Mazda service in this region?

The nearest Mazda dealerships are in larger cities like Dubuque or Cedar Rapids, which is a consideration for travel. For most routine maintenance and repairs, a trusted local independent shop in Dyersville can provide quality, convenient service, often at a lower cost, while dealerships may be necessary for complex warranty or recall work.
